Peer reviewedGold, Maria-Valeri – Journal of the Freshman Year Experience, 1992
A four-week summer program at Georgia State University prepares entering African-American students for college work through instruction in mathematics, reading, composition, study skills, word processing, tutoring, academic and career counseling, mentoring, and follow-up. The program has been well received and succeeded in enhancing retention.…

Burkheimer, Graham J. Jr.; And Others – 1979
This report presents findings from the third of a series of studies of the Upward Bound (UB) program. The study was conducted between April, 1978, and September, 1979, to investigate long-term educational outcomes of UB program participation. The Upward Bound program was designed for low income high school students with potential for successfully…
